May 2025 - Apr 2026Burlington Road area has the 36th highest crime rate of 128 local areas in Crystal Palace & Upper Norwood , and the 343rd highest crime rate of 1,070 local areas in Croydon .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Burlington Road (CR7 8PE) in the last 12 months was 109.0 per 1,000 residents and was 25.5% higher than the Crystal Palace & Upper Norwood average (86.9 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 9 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Shoplifting 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 12 (≈ 37.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-10.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Burlington Road (CR7 8PE), the main crime hotspot is near Beulah Crescent. Police recorded 48 crimes here, including 18 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
